ActiveLayerIndex 0 ApplicationVersion com.omnigroup.OmniGraffle 139.18.0.187838 AutoAdjust BackgroundGraphic Bounds {{0, 0}, {558.99997329711914, 783}} Class SolidGraphic ID 2 Style shadow Draws NO stroke Draws NO BaseZoom 0 CanvasOrigin {0, 0} ColumnAlign 1 ColumnSpacing 36 CreationDate 2014-03-24 09:32:25 +0000 Creator Andy Jeffries DisplayScale 1 0/72 in = 1.0000 in GraphDocumentVersion 8 GraphicsList Class LineGraphic Head ID 41 Info 2 ID 42 Points {84.5, 587} {84.5, 628} Style stroke HeadArrow FilledArrow Legacy LineType 1 TailArrow 0 Tail ID 23 Info 1 Bounds {{20, 628}, {129, 50}} Class ShapedGraphic ID 41 Magnets {0, 1} {0, -1} {1, 0} {-1, 0} Shape Rectangle Style stroke Pattern 1 Text Text {\rtf1\ansi\ansicpg1252\cocoartf1265\cocoasubrtf190 \cocoascreenfonts1{\fonttbl\f0\fswiss\fcharset0 Helvetica;} {\colortbl;\red255\green255\blue255;} \pard\tx560\tx1120\tx1680\tx2240\tx2800\tx3360\tx3920\tx4480\tx5040\tx5600\tx6160\tx6720\qc \f0\fs20 \cf0 Rails.logger\ (by default)} Class LineGraphic Head ID 25 ID 40 Points {369, 178} {160, 96} Style stroke HeadArrow FilledArrow Legacy LineType 1 TailArrow 0 Tail ID 19 Class LineGraphic Head ID 18 ID 39 Points {160, 96} {369, 71} Style stroke HeadArrow FilledArrow Legacy LineType 1 TailArrow 0 Tail ID 25 Info 3 Class LineGraphic Head ID 21 Info 4 ID 38 Points {357.49998664855957, 354.5} {389, 429.5} Style stroke HeadArrow FilledArrow Legacy LineType 1 TailArrow 0 Tail ID 11 Class LineGraphic Head ID 20 Info 4 ID 37 Points {357.49998664855957, 354.5} {389, 366.5} Style stroke HeadArrow FilledArrow Legacy LineType 1 TailArrow 0 Tail ID 11 Info 3 Class LineGraphic Head ID 24 ID 36 Points {201.49998664855957, 354.5} {149, 297} Style stroke HeadArrow FilledArrow Legacy LineType 1 TailArrow 0 Tail ID 11 Class LineGraphic Head ID 23 ID 35 Points {201.49998664855957, 354.5} {84.5, 537} Style stroke HeadArrow FilledArrow Legacy LineType 1 TailArrow 0 Tail ID 11 Class LineGraphic Head ID 27 ID 34 Points {453.5, 567} {453.5, 619} Style stroke HeadArrow FilledArrow Legacy LineType 1 TailArrow 0 Tail ID 22 Info 1 Class LineGraphic Head ID 22 ID 33 Points {279.49998664855957, 484} {389, 542} Style stroke HeadArrow FilledArrow Legacy LineType 1 TailArrow 0 Tail ID 11 Info 1 Class LineGraphic Head ID 28 Info 2 ID 32 Points {279.49998664855957, 484} {268, 537} Style stroke HeadArrow FilledArrow Legacy LineType 1 TailArrow 0 Tail ID 11 Info 1 Class LineGraphic Head ID 25 Info 1 ID 31 Points {279.49998664855957, 225} {95.5, 121} Style stroke HeadArrow FilledArrow Legacy LineType 1 TailArrow 0 Tail ID 11 Class LineGraphic Head ID 19 ID 30 Points {433.5, 96} {433.5, 153} Style stroke HeadArrow FilledArrow Legacy LineType 1 TailArrow 0 Tail ID 18 Info 1 Class LineGraphic Head ID 26 Info 2 ID 29 Points {95.5, 121} {95.5, 198} Style stroke HeadArrow FilledArrow Legacy LineType 1 TailArrow 0 Tail ID 25 Info 1 Bounds {{203.5, 537}, {129, 50}} Class ShapedGraphic ID 28 Magnets {0, 1} {0, -1} {1, 0} {-1, 0} Shape Rectangle Style stroke Pattern 1 Text Text {\rtf1\ansi\ansicpg1252\cocoartf1265\cocoasubrtf190 \cocoascreenfonts1{\fonttbl\f0\fswiss\fcharset0 Helvetica;} {\colortbl;\red255\green255\blue255;} \pard\tx560\tx1120\tx1680\tx2240\tx2800\tx3360\tx3920\tx4480\tx5040\tx5600\tx6160\tx6720\qc \f0\fs20 \cf0 Your Class Goes Here} Bounds {{389, 619}, {129, 50}} Class ShapedGraphic ID 27 Magnets {0, 1} {0, -1} {1, 0} {-1, 0} Shape Rectangle Style stroke Pattern 1 Text Text {\rtf1\ansi\ansicpg1252\cocoartf1265\cocoasubrtf190 \cocoascreenfonts1{\fonttbl\f0\fswiss\fcharset0 Helvetica;} {\colortbl;\red255\green255\blue255;} \pard\tx560\tx1120\tx1680\tx2240\tx2800\tx3360\tx3920\tx4480\tx5040\tx5600\tx6160\tx6720\qc \f0\fs20 \cf0 Your Proxy Goes Here} Bounds {{31, 198}, {129, 50}} Class ShapedGraphic ID 26 Magnets {0, 1} {0, -1} {1, 0} {-1, 0} Shape Rectangle Text Text {\rtf1\ansi\ansicpg1252\cocoartf1265\cocoasubrtf190 \cocoascreenfonts1{\fonttbl\f0\fswiss\fcharset0 Helvetica;} {\colortbl;\red255\green255\blue255;} \pard\tx560\tx1120\tx1680\tx2240\tx2800\tx3360\tx3920\tx4480\tx5040\tx5600\tx6160\tx6720\qc \f0\fs20 \cf0 Header List} Bounds {{31, 71}, {129, 50}} Class ShapedGraphic ID 25 Magnets {0, 1} {0, -1} {1, 0} {-1, 0} Shape Rectangle Text Text {\rtf1\ansi\ansicpg1252\cocoartf1265\cocoasubrtf190 \cocoascreenfonts1{\fonttbl\f0\fswiss\fcharset0 Helvetica;} {\colortbl;\red255\green255\blue255;} \pard\tx560\tx1120\tx1680\tx2240\tx2800\tx3360\tx3920\tx4480\tx5040\tx5600\tx6160\tx6720\qc \f0\fs20 \cf0 Request} Bounds {{20, 272}, {129, 50}} Class ShapedGraphic ID 24 Magnets {0, 1} {0, -1} {1, 0} {-1, 0} Shape Rectangle Text Text {\rtf1\ansi\ansicpg1252\cocoartf1265\cocoasubrtf190 \cocoascreenfonts1{\fonttbl\f0\fswiss\fcharset0 Helvetica;} {\colortbl;\red255\green255\blue255;} \pard\tx560\tx1120\tx1680\tx2240\tx2800\tx3360\tx3920\tx4480\tx5040\tx5600\tx6160\tx6720\qc \f0\fs20 \cf0 Result Iterator} Bounds {{20, 537}, {129, 50}} Class ShapedGraphic ID 23 Magnets {0, 1} {0, -1} {1, 0} {-1, 0} Shape Rectangle Text Text {\rtf1\ansi\ansicpg1252\cocoartf1265\cocoasubrtf190 \cocoascreenfonts1{\fonttbl\f0\fswiss\fcharset0 Helvetica;} {\colortbl;\red255\green255\blue255;} \pard\tx560\tx1120\tx1680\tx2240\tx2800\tx3360\tx3920\tx4480\tx5040\tx5600\tx6160\tx6720\qc \f0\fs20 \cf0 Logger} Bounds {{389, 517}, {129, 50}} Class ShapedGraphic ID 22 Magnets {0, 1} {0, -1} {1, 0} {-1, 0} Shape Rectangle Text Text {\rtf1\ansi\ansicpg1252\cocoartf1265\cocoasubrtf190 \cocoascreenfonts1{\fonttbl\f0\fswiss\fcharset0 Helvetica;} {\colortbl;\red255\green255\blue255;} \pard\tx560\tx1120\tx1680\tx2240\tx2800\tx3360\tx3920\tx4480\tx5040\tx5600\tx6160\tx6720\qc \f0\fs20 \cf0 ProxyBase} Bounds {{389, 404.5}, {129, 50}} Class ShapedGraphic ID 21 Magnets {0, 1} {0, -1} {1, 0} {-1, 0} Shape Rectangle Text Text {\rtf1\ansi\ansicpg1252\cocoartf1265\cocoasubrtf190 \cocoascreenfonts1{\fonttbl\f0\fswiss\fcharset0 Helvetica;} {\colortbl;\red255\green255\blue255;} \pard\tx560\tx1120\tx1680\tx2240\tx2800\tx3360\tx3920\tx4480\tx5040\tx5600\tx6160\tx6720\qc \f0\fs20 \cf0 Lazy Association Loader} Bounds {{389, 341.5}, {129, 50}} Class ShapedGraphic ID 20 Magnets {0, 1} {0, -1} {1, 0} {-1, 0} Shape Rectangle Text Text {\rtf1\ansi\ansicpg1252\cocoartf1265\cocoasubrtf190 \cocoascreenfonts1{\fonttbl\f0\fswiss\fcharset0 Helvetica;} {\colortbl;\red255\green255\blue255;} \pard\tx560\tx1120\tx1680\tx2240\tx2800\tx3360\tx3920\tx4480\tx5040\tx5600\tx6160\tx6720\qc \f0\fs20 \cf0 Lazy Loader} Bounds {{369, 153}, {129, 50}} Class ShapedGraphic ID 19 Magnets {0, 1} {0, -1} {1, 0} {-1, 0} Shape Rectangle Text Text {\rtf1\ansi\ansicpg1252\cocoartf1265\cocoasubrtf190 \cocoascreenfonts1{\fonttbl\f0\fswiss\fcharset0 Helvetica;} {\colortbl;\red255\green255\blue255;} \pard\tx560\tx1120\tx1680\tx2240\tx2800\tx3360\tx3920\tx4480\tx5040\tx5600\tx6160\tx6720\qc \f0\fs20 \cf0 Connection} Bounds {{369, 46}, {129, 50}} Class ShapedGraphic ID 18 Magnets {0, 1} {0, -1} {1, 0} {-1, 0} Shape Rectangle Text Text {\rtf1\ansi\ansicpg1252\cocoartf1265\cocoasubrtf190 \cocoascreenfonts1{\fonttbl\f0\fswiss\fcharset0 Helvetica;} {\colortbl;\red255\green255\blue255;} \pard\tx560\tx1120\tx1680\tx2240\tx2800\tx3360\tx3920\tx4480\tx5040\tx5600\tx6160\tx6720\qc \f0\fs20 \cf0 Connection\ Manager} Bounds {{214.49998664855957, 447.5}, {129, 24.5}} Class ShapedGraphic ID 17 Magnets {0, 1} {0, -1} {1, 0} {-1, 0} Shape Rectangle Text Text {\rtf1\ansi\ansicpg1252\cocoartf1265\cocoasubrtf190 \cocoascreenfonts1{\fonttbl\f0\fswiss\fcharset0 Helvetica;} {\colortbl;\red255\green255\blue255;} \pard\tx560\tx1120\tx1680\tx2240\tx2800\tx3360\tx3920\tx4480\tx5040\tx5600\tx6160\tx6720\qc \f0\fs20 \cf0 Recording} Bounds {{214.49998664855957, 411.5}, {129, 24.5}} Class ShapedGraphic ID 16 Magnets {0, 1} {0, -1} {1, 0} {-1, 0} Shape Rectangle Text Text {\rtf1\ansi\ansicpg1252\cocoartf1265\cocoasubrtf190 \cocoascreenfonts1{\fonttbl\f0\fswiss\fcharset0 Helvetica;} {\colortbl;\red255\green255\blue255;} \pard\tx560\tx1120\tx1680\tx2240\tx2800\tx3360\tx3920\tx4480\tx5040\tx5600\tx6160\tx6720\qc \f0\fs20 \cf0 Caching} Bounds {{214.49998664855957, 375.5}, {129, 24.5}} Class ShapedGraphic ID 15 Magnets {0, 1} {0, -1} {1, 0} {-1, 0} Shape Rectangle Text Text {\rtf1\ansi\ansicpg1252\cocoartf1265\cocoasubrtf190 \cocoascreenfonts1{\fonttbl\f0\fswiss\fcharset0 Helvetica;} {\colortbl;\red255\green255\blue255;} \pard\tx560\tx1120\tx1680\tx2240\tx2800\tx3360\tx3920\tx4480\tx5040\tx5600\tx6160\tx6720\qc \f0\fs20 \cf0 Validation} Bounds {{214.49998664855957, 339.5}, {129, 24.5}} Class ShapedGraphic ID 14 Magnets {0, 1} {0, -1} {1, 0} {-1, 0} Shape Rectangle Text Text {\rtf1\ansi\ansicpg1252\cocoartf1265\cocoasubrtf190 \cocoascreenfonts1{\fonttbl\f0\fswiss\fcharset0 Helvetica;} {\colortbl;\red255\green255\blue255;} \pard\tx560\tx1120\tx1680\tx2240\tx2800\tx3360\tx3920\tx4480\tx5040\tx5600\tx6160\tx6720\qc \f0\fs20 \cf0 Request Filtering} Bounds {{214.49998664855957, 303.5}, {129, 24.5}} Class ShapedGraphic ID 13 Magnets {0, 1} {0, -1} {1, 0} {-1, 0} Shape Rectangle Text Text {\rtf1\ansi\ansicpg1252\cocoartf1265\cocoasubrtf190 \cocoascreenfonts1{\fonttbl\f0\fswiss\fcharset0 Helvetica;} {\colortbl;\red255\green255\blue255;} \pard\tx560\tx1120\tx1680\tx2240\tx2800\tx3360\tx3920\tx4480\tx5040\tx5600\tx6160\tx6720\qc \f0\fs20 \cf0 Mapping} Bounds {{214.49998664855957, 267.5}, {129, 24.5}} Class ShapedGraphic ID 12 Magnets {0, 1} {0, -1} {1, 0} {-1, 0} Shape Rectangle Text Text {\rtf1\ansi\ansicpg1252\cocoartf1265\cocoasubrtf190 \cocoascreenfonts1{\fonttbl\f0\fswiss\fcharset0 Helvetica;} {\colortbl;\red255\green255\blue255;} \pard\tx560\tx1120\tx1680\tx2240\tx2800\tx3360\tx3920\tx4480\tx5040\tx5600\tx6160\tx6720\qc \f0\fs20 \cf0 Configuration} Bounds {{201.49998664855957, 225}, {156, 259}} Class ShapedGraphic ID 11 Magnets {0, 1} {0, -1} {1, 0} {-1, 0} Shape Rectangle Style Text Text {\rtf1\ansi\ansicpg1252\cocoartf1265\cocoasubrtf190 \cocoascreenfonts1{\fonttbl\f0\fswiss\fcharset0 Helvetica;} {\colortbl;\red255\green255\blue255;} \pard\tx560\tx1120\tx1680\tx2240\tx2800\tx3360\tx3920\tx4480\tx5040\tx5600\tx6160\tx6720\qc \f0\fs20 \cf0 Base} TextPlacement 0 GridInfo GuidesLocked NO GuidesVisible YES HPages 1 ImageCounter 1 KeepToScale Layers Lock NO Name Layer 1 Print YES View YES LayoutInfo Animate NO circoMinDist 18 circoSeparation 0.0 layoutEngine dot neatoSeparation 0.0 twopiSeparation 0.0 LinksVisible NO MagnetsVisible NO MasterSheets ModificationDate 2014-03-26 10:37:19 +0000 Modifier Andy Jeffries NotesVisible NO Orientation 2 OriginVisible NO PageBreaks YES PrintInfo NSBottomMargin float 41 NSHorizonalPagination coded BAtzdHJlYW10eXBlZIHoA4QBQISEhAhOU051bWJlcgCEhAdOU1ZhbHVlAISECE5TT2JqZWN0AIWEASqEhAFxlwCG NSLeftMargin float 18 NSPaperSize size {594.99997329711914, 842} NSPrintReverseOrientation int 0 NSRightMargin float 18 NSTopMargin float 18 PrintOnePage ReadOnly NO RowAlign 1 RowSpacing 36 SheetTitle Canvas 1 SmartAlignmentGuidesActive YES SmartDistanceGuidesActive YES UniqueID 1 UseEntirePage VPages 1 WindowInfo CurrentSheet 0 ExpandedCanvases name Canvas 1 Frame {{36, 4}, {693, 874}} ListView OutlineWidth 142 RightSidebar ShowRuler Sidebar SidebarWidth 120 VisibleRegion {{0, 2}, {558, 735}} Zoom 1 ZoomValues Canvas 1 1 1